    Admission Details

    The Admission is based on the MHT CET 2023 scorecard / JEE 2023 (Main) Scorecard.

    Admission is based on obtaining a non-zero score in JEE or CET, as per the guidelines prescribed by the Director of Technical Education, Govt. of Maharashtra eligible for First-Year Engineering admission.

    ... read more

    Eligibility Criteria

    Passed HSC or its equivalent examination with Physics and Mathematics as compulsory subjects along with one of the Chemistry or Biotechnology or Biology or Technical or Vocational subjects, and obtained at least 45% marks (at least 40% marks, in case of Backward class categories and Persons with Disability candidates belonging to Maharashtra State only).

    Or 

    Passed Diploma in Engineering and Technology and obtained at least 45 % marks (at least 40 % marks, in case of Backward class categories and Persons with Disability candidates belonging to Maharashtra State only).

    Or 

     Passed B.Sc. Degree from a Recognized University as defined by UGC and obtained at least 50 % marks (at least 45% marks, in case of Backward class categories and Persons with Disability candidates belonging to Maharashtra State only) and passed XII standard with Mathematics as a subject.

    ... read more

    The  HSC (10+2) or its equivalent examination with a minimum of 50% marks in Physics, Mathematics, and Chemistry/Biology/Biotechnology/Technical Vocational Subject (45% marks for reservation category).

    Lateral Entry

    Diploma in Engineering, with 50% marks (45% marks for the reservation category), is eligible for Direct Second Year Engineering admission.
